[quote=Anonymous]MB here. Earlier pp is right - it's time to talk w/ your employers about how they view these moments. That said, I think both adults can/should discipline and the scenario you describe is a perfect opportunity to back each other up and make sure the child knows that the expectations are the same no matter who is there. In our house we typically let the nanny be the one "in charge" whenever she's on the clock. But if I or my husband see a child not listening to her, or not behaving in a way that he or she knows they should, or being disrespectful to the nanny, etc... then we back the nanny up. When our nanny was new we stepped in sooner, because it gave her a chance to see how we handled things, but now all three of us approach things similarly.[/quote]
